]> source.dussan.org Git - sonarqube.git/commitdiff
SONAR-6387 Improve technical debt display in Rules
authorStas Vilchik <vilchiks@gmail.com>
Mon, 20 Apr 2015 11:34:23 +0000 (13:34 +0200)
committerStas Vilchik <vilchiks@gmail.com>
Mon, 20 Apr 2015 11:34:23 +0000 (13:34 +0200)
server/sonar-web/src/main/hbs/coding-rules/rule/coding-rules-rule-meta.hbs

index fab7db7ede78d51552b2843baf02671333c09593..31b1ca0925ed00fcf753a3eaeae5f7416921306f 100644 (file)
     {{#if debtRemFnType}}
       <li class="coding-rules-detail-property"
           data-toggle="tooltip" data-placement="bottom" title="{{t 'coding_rules.remediation_function'}}">
-        {{t 'coding_rules.remediation_function' debtRemFnType}}
-      </li>
-    {{/if}}
+        {{t 'coding_rules.remediation_function' debtRemFnType}}:
 
-    {{#if debtRemFnCoeff}}
-      <li class="coding-rules-detail-property"
-          data-toggle="tooltip" data-placement="bottom"
-          title="{{#if effortToFixDescription}}{{effortToFixDescription}}{{else}}{{t 'coding_rules.remediation_function.coeff'}}{{/if}}">
-        {{debtRemFnCoeff}}
-      </li>
-    {{/if}}
-
-    {{#if debtRemFnOffset}}
-      <li class="coding-rules-detail-property"
-          data-toggle="tooltip" data-placement="bottom"
-          title="{{#eq debtRemFnType 'CONSTANT_ISSUE'}}{{t 'coding_rules.remediation_function.constant'}}{{else}}{{t 'coding_rules.remediation_function.offset'}}{{/eq}}">
-        {{debtRemFnOffset}}
+        {{#if debtRemFnOffset}}{{debtRemFnOffset}}{{/if}}
+        {{#if debtRemFnCoeff}}{{#if debtRemFnOffset}}+{{/if}}{{debtRemFnCoeff}}{{/if}}
+        {{#if effortToFixDescription}}{{effortToFixDescription}}{{/if}}
       </li>
     {{/if}}
   </ul>